They are jinfo mountain in nanchuan county ( natural protection section ), wuling mountain in qianjiang county ( national emphases forest demonstration county which forest cover rate is beyond 50 % ) and zhongliang mountain in beibei county ( artificial destruction is very grave ). some main land use patterns i. e. woodland, garden, infield, abandon infield, shrub and grassplot are selected in those three sample sites. four aspects on soil fertility index of karst environment under different land use patterns in these three sample sites, are revealed in this paper, by using the field test, indoor measure and analysis, outdoor experiment and field investigation, and the knowledge and technique of soil, ecology, physics and chemistry etc. they are physical characteristic ( effective soil thickness, organic layer thickness, soil texture, water - stable aggregate and soil water etc. ), chemical fertility ( organism, omni - n, omni - p, omni - k, alkali - nitrogen, available p, available k and rapid available k etc. ), soil animalcule ( bacteria, fungi, actinomyces and their grosses ) and soil - seed - pool ( plant community diversity index ) in karst ecosystem

The thesis is based on income question, forest coverage rate and grop production. to beging with, date envelopment analysis is proved that it can be applicated into grain for green in shan - bei district, and then in view of the fact, seven esential factors which have influence on the project are found out : expense of dam, expense of crop, expense of cash tree, expense of defense tree, other economic crop, expense of grass and graziery ; and the output factors include : income of gdp, pure income per captia, the area of decreasing land loss, graziery income, crop production, income of tree, the totle income of economic crop. after the date of each facts are puted into dea model, unefficiencial decision making units ( dmu ) found. the data that are got through adjusting unefficiencial dmus dy dea can offer guide in shanbei district upgrading of an industrial structure. at the same time, taking into account some possible problems in or after grain for green in shan - bei district, the thesis bring out some propesal to improve the circ umstance, enhance the life level and put the relation of population, resource and circumstance into a healthy orbit
